Rodney Yee's Yoga for Your Week is quite the interesting watch if you're into wellness films or yoga specifically. The whole vibe is all about fitting yoga into a busy schedule, which resonates with a lot of us these days. Each of the five practices is tailored to deliver specific benefits, like focus and relaxation, and the pacing feels approachable, not rushed. The absence of a known director adds a certain charm, making it feel more like a personal guide than a polished production. There's something distinctly laid-back about Yee’s demeanor that draws you in, and you can sense his genuine passion for yoga throughout the sessions.
This film is relatively obscure in the yoga genre, making it a unique find for collectors. Its straightforward presentation and practical approach to yoga have fostered a niche interest among enthusiasts looking for accessible wellness routines. There are limited editions available, primarily on DVD, but finding a good condition copy can be a bit of a treasure hunt. Overall, it sits in that sweet spot of being both useful and collectible.
